Broken Key Extraction

Key snapped in the lock? We remove broken fragments without damaging the cylinder, then test the lock and cut a new key if needed.

Stuck or Jammed Lock Repair

Lock won't turn? We diagnose whether it's debris, worn pins, or misalignment — then repair or lubricate to restore smooth operation.

Loose Handle & Knob Repair

Wobbly knob? Loose rose? We tighten internal components, replace worn springs, and secure hardware so it feels solid again.

Deadbolt Mechanism Fix

Bolt sticks? Won't extend fully? We adjust strike plates, lubricate mechanisms, or replace internal parts to restore reliable locking.
